Description
This image depicts European Mistletoe (Viscum album), a parasitic plant characterized by its dense cluster of green, segmented stems, small oval leaves, and numerous translucent white berries. It is not a traditional bonsai specimen, lacking the distinct trunk and root system typically cultivated in bonsai art.
